SafeNotes

SafeNotes

Security & Privacy

SafeNotes is a free, open-source, encrypted note taking application for Windows, Mac, Linux, iOS and Android. It allows users to securely store text, code snippets, passwords, and more with AES-256 bit encryption. Useful for taking quick notes or storing sensitive information.

SynWrite

SynWrite

Development

SynWrite is a lightweight text editor and code editor for Windows. It has syntax highlighting, code folding, auto-completion, macros, and other coding-focused features. It aims to balance being lightweight while still providing useful functionality for programmers.
